Sackcloth and ashes benefit no one.

Shall we have another turn ?" "Not yet," Penelope replied.

"Wait till the crowd thins a little.

Tell me what you have been doing today ?" "Pretty strenuous time," Sir Charles remarked.

"Up at nine, played golf at Ranelagh all morning, lunched down there, back to my rooms and changed, called on my tailor, went round to the club, had one game of billiards and four rubbers of bridge." "Is that all ?" Penelope asked.
The faint sarcasm which lurked beneath her question passed unnoticed.
Sir Charles smiled good-humoredly.
"Not quite," he answered.
